Helped to evade mobilization: Former secretary of Kyiv City Council served with notice of suspicion

The former secretary of the Kyiv City Council is suspected of official negligence and aiding in evasion of military service.

The State Bureau of Investigation reported this.

How a former official helped to evade mobilization

It is noted that the former secretary of the Kyiv City Council illegally paid salaries to the Kyiv City Council manager in 2022-2023, despite the fact that he, along with other deputies, was mobilized into the ranks of the Armed Forces of Ukraine.

“He knew for sure that the latter was doing military service. His actions caused damage to the state in the amount of more than 690 thousand hryvnia,” the report says.

In addition, the former official sent a letter to the Kyiv City Military-Civil Administration with a request to send a mobilized employee to work in the Kiev City Council, although there were no positions there that could be filled by military personnel.

“Thus, he effectively evaded military service, did not report to the military unit, and did not perform any tasks to defend Ukraine,” the State Bureau of Investigation emphasized.

All these facts are confirmed by documents that the bureau collected during the pre-trial investigation, forensic economic examination and audit research, the report says.
